Juventus End Talks For Chelsea Midfielder Jorginho

By Daily sports on August 11, 2020

Juventus have ended their interest in Chelsea midfielder Jorginho.

Juve have switched their attention from Chelsea midfielder Jorginho to Brescia wonderkid Sandro Tonali due to the sacking of Maurizio Sarri.

Tuttosport says there is now no interest in signing Jorginho and Andrea Pirlo, successor to Sarri, instead wants the Italian champions to make a push to sign Tonali.

With Juve reportedly withdrawing their interest, it raises questions as to whether Jorginho will continue under Frank Lampard at Stamford Bridge.

The Italian produced just two assists in the Premier League in 2019-20 having made 31 appearances. (Tribal Football)
